The match was played at the Estadio La Rosaleda stadium in Málaga on Saturday and it started at 6:15 pm local time. In front of 18,004 spectators.​ The referee was Juan Luis Pulido Santana assisted by Francisco José Arencibia Medina and José Miguel Bordoy Homar. The 4th official was Juan Antonio Campos Salinas. The weather was cloudy. The temperature was pleasant at 21 degrees Celsius or 69.82 Fahrenheit. The humidity was 56%.​

Ball possession

Real Valladolid was in firm control of the ball 63% while Málaga was struggling with a 37% ball possession.

Attitude and shots

Real Valladolid was more pushing with 71 dangerous attacks and 19 shots of which 7 were on target. However, that was not enough Real Valladolid to win the contest​.

Málaga shot 16 times, 4 on target, 12 off target. Talking about the opposition, Real Valladolid shot 19 times, 7 on target, 12 off target.

Cards

Málaga received 5 yellow cards (A. Caro Serrano, A. Febas, B. Llamas, Vadillo and R. Enriquez). Talking about the opposition, Real Valladolid received 2 yellow cards (A. M. Tuhami and S. Leon).

Standings

After playing this match, Málaga will have 38 points to sit in the 18th place. On the other side, Real Valladolid will have 65 points to remain in the 2nd place.

Next matches

In the next match in the La Liga 2, Málaga will play away against Leganés on the 16th of April with a 5-1 head to head record in favor of Leganés (1 draw).

Real Valladolid will host Almería on the 16th of April with a 7-6 head to head record in favor of Real Valladolid (9 draws).
